Christmas Pasta with Figs, Green Olives and Ricotta

Vegetarian festive pasta with figs, green olives, ricotta and thyme.

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Serving Size 4 People

Ingredients

  • 1 onion
  • 4 figs
  • 150 grams pitted green olives drained weight
  • 10 sprigs fresh thyme
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 400 grams pasta
  • 250 grams ricotta

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 180 degrees Celsius.
  • Peel and chop your onion. Cut each fig into 8 equal pieces.
  • Put the onions and figs onto a baking tray. Add the drained green olives and 5 sprigs of thyme. Drizzle over 1 tablespoon of olive o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Put in the oven for 20 minutes.
  • Meanwhile cook the pasta according to packet instructions until al dente.
  • Drain the pasta. Toss with the figs, olives and onion. Drizzle in 2 tablespoons of olive oil and stir.
  • Serve into bowls and top with a spoonful of ricotta and a sprinkle of the remaining thyme.
